fbpx

What is Python Programming

python programming

Python is one among the top 10 popular programming languages of 2017. Python is a high-level programming language used for developing desktop GUI applications, websites and web applications. It takes care of common programming tasks and allows you to focus on the core functionality of the application.

The simple syntax rules of Python language makes it more popular and easier for you to keep the code base readable and application maintainable. There are many reasons to prefer Python than any other programming languages.

  • Easy to Learn
  • Code Readability
  • Compatible with Major Platforms and Systems
  • Multiple-Programming Paradigms
  • Simplify Complex Software Development

Python Training in Kerala, Kochi

Python Programming Syllabus

 

Module – 1 Python Introduction(2 hours)

  • Welcome To The Course
  • Why Python
  • Software Installation and Environment Setup
  • Python Program to Print Hello world!
  • Python Statement, Indentation and Comments
  • Python Variables
  • Python literals
  • Python Operators
  • Python Input/Output
  • INTERVIEW QUESTIONS ASSIGNMENT

 

Module – 2 Python Flow Control(3 hours)

  • Python if…else Statement
  • Python for Loop
  • Python while Loop
  • Python break and continue
  • Python pass Statement
  • INTERVIEW QUESTIONS ASSIGNMENT

 

Module – 3 Python Data Types(4 hours)

  • Python Numbers
  • Python List
  • Python Tuple
  • Python String
  • Python Set
  • Python Dictionary
  • INTERVIEW QUESTIONS ASSIGNMENT

 

Module – 4 Python Functions(4 hours)

  • Python Function
  • Function Argument
  • Python Recursion
  • Lambda Function
  • Global, Local and Nonlocal
  • Python Modules and Packages
  • INTERVIEW QUESTIONS ASSIGNMENT

 

Module – 5 Python Object & Class(4 hours)

  • Python OOP
  • Python Class
  • Inheritance
  • Multiple Inheritance
  • Operator Overloading
  • INTERVIEW QUESTIONS ASSIGNMENT

 

Module – 6 Error Handling and File Operations (4 hours)

  • Python File Operation
  • Python Directory
  • Python Exception
  • Exception Handling
  • INTERVIEW QUESTIONS ASSIGNMENT

 

Module – 7 Advanced Topics(3 hours)

  • Python Iterator
  • Python Generator
  • Python Closure
  • Python Decorators
  • Python RegEx
  • Python Datetime
  • Python Math
  • INTERVIEW QUESTIONS ASSIGNMENT

 

Module – 8 Database (4 hours)

  • Python MySQL
  • Working with PDFs and CSV Files
  • INTERVIEW QUESTIONS ASSIGNMENT

 

Module -9 Pillow and Tkinter(5 hours)

  • Working with Images in Python
  • Python GUI
  • INTERVIEW QUESTIONS ASSIGNMENT

 

Module – 10 What’s Next in Learning?(5 hours)

  • Emails with Python
  • Web Scraping with Python
  • What’s Next
  • INTERVIEW QUESTIONS ASSIGNMENT
Enquire now